Output d8516f326b09794324df3c9d7158d3bfa1689e7c5663ad9173f1b270b4a96c50:2

value
118544967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34ff933d2cdea04611ce9049f8fd58ad08721cae OP_EQUAL
address
36XFEC5YrC9JgC9TEcXxEV2sL5ATyZE8oE
transaction
d8516f326b09794324df3c9d7158d3bfa1689e7c5663ad9173f1b270b4a96c50
spent
true